My first pick was RODE NT1-A but it seems to have a 48V Phantom power and the AER supports just 25V mics right?
...
|
The Rode website says the Rode NT1-A will work with 24v or 48v phantom power.
https://www.rode.com/microphones/nt1-a
Most condenser mics are designed to work with 3 wire phantom power in the range of 9v to 52v. A minority require a full 48v.
